Research performance overview

Alice-Salomon-Hochschule Berlin is an education institution in Germany represented in the ITS Research Intelligence database through OpenAlex and ROR-linked identity data. Over the most recent five-year window available locally, the institution is associated with 553 research works and 10,000 citations. Its current h-index is 71, while the five-year trend shows a contraction in recent publication activity. It currently places #6,323 in the ITS global research-performance ranking. Within Germany, its current research-performance position is #152.

Recent citation volume is approximately 18.1 citations per five-year work when the two aggregate windows are divided. This is a descriptive ratio rather than a field-normalized citation indicator, because disciplines have very different citation practices. The h-index and i10-index add longer-run visibility context, while the growth metrics show direction of travel rather than historical accumulation alone.

Research strengths and leading topics

Health and Medical StudiesSociology and Education StudiesSocial and Demographic Issues in GermanyMigration, Health and TraumaPsychology, Coaching, and TherapyMedical Practices and RehabilitationPsychiatric care and mental health servicesSocial Policies and Healthcare ReformClinical practice guidelines implementationMedical and Health Sciences Research

The strongest topic signals currently associated with Alice-Salomon-Hochschule Berlin include Health and Medical Studies, Sociology and Education Studies and Social and Demographic Issues in Germany. Topic lists are useful for understanding where an institution is visibly active, but they are not equivalent to a complete departmental census because OpenAlex topics are inferred from the institution’s works rather than from its administrative structure.

National benchmark

Among the 311 index-ready universities currently available for Germany, the average five-year output is about 2,525 works and the average five-year citation count is about 12,882. Alice-Salomon-Hochschule Berlin is currently below that research-output average and below the citation average. Its own growth signal is -32.6%, compared with a country-set average of 37.2%.

How to interpret this university profile

ITS Research Solution treats this page as research intelligence rather than a prestige label. The score is designed to summarize measurable research activity using recent output, recent citations, h-index, i10-index and five-year publication growth. Size still matters, so the score should be interpreted together with the trend table and topic profile. A smaller institution with strong momentum can therefore look different from a large institution with a much longer publication history.

Rankings are recalculated from the local analytical database after OpenAlex synchronization. The public page is indexable only when the institution has enough recent research activity, at least five active years in the available trend window, and multiple topic signals. This quality gate prevents empty or minimally populated institution records from becoming search-engine pages.
